引言

        随着区块链技术的迅速发展,隐私保护已经成为一个愈发重要的话题。虽然区块链本身具有不可篡改和透明的特性,但这些特性同时也给个人隐私带来了潜在的威胁。因此,区块链隐私保护协议的研究与实践出现了蓬勃的发展,探讨如何在保证交易透明的同时保护用户的隐私。本文将对几种主要的区块链隐私保护协议进行深入分析,并讨论其在现实中的应用,以及未来的发展趋势。

        一、区块链隐私保护的必要性

        在区块链的早期应用中,如比特币,所有交易都是公开的,交易记录被永久保存在公共账本中。这种设计虽然保证了透明度,但同时也让用户的交易行为可以被任何人追踪,导致个人隐私泄露的风险。因此,在许多行业中,如何妥善保护用户隐私成为了一个序任重而道远的挑战。

        隐私保护不仅关系到个人的安全和自由,也在社会经济的建设上变得至关重要。假如用户数据和交易历史频繁曝光,这将影响到个人信任和区块链的整体信誉。因此,隐私保护协议的有效性直接关系到区块链技术的普及与发展。

        二、主要隐私保护协议解析

        1. 零知识证明(Zero-Knowledge Proof)

        零知识证明是一种密码学协议,让一方(证实者)能够向另一方(验证者)证明某个陈述是正确的,而无需释放任何额外的信息。这种协议被广泛应用于隐私保护中,特别是在Zcash这样的隐私币中。

        Zcash利用零知识证明确保用户的交易信息不被披露。通过使用zk-SNARKs(零知识简洁非交互式知识论证),用户能够完成交易,同时不暴露发送者、接收者及交易金额等敏感信息。这种方式不仅保证了交易的安全性,同时也满足了隐私保护的需求。

        2. 环签名(Ring Signature)

        环签名是一种可以实现匿名性的签名协议,最早由大卫·马库斯和神户大学的技术团队于2001年提出。环签名的特点是允许一组用户共同进行签名,而其中无法识别出具体的签名者。Monero便采用了环签名技术。

        在Monero中,每次交易都包含一个环签名,这意味着外部观察者无法确定参与者的真实身份。交易的匿名性极大增强,保证了用户的隐私不被侵犯。此外,Monero还结合了其他隐私技术,如隐蔽地址和环交易,进一步强化了交易的私密性。

        3. 瞬时交易(Stealth Addresses)

        瞬时交易是一种允许只对特定交易的发起者和接收者可见的地址。通过使用这种技术,即便交易记录被公开,但交易双方的身份仍然无法被识别。Stealth地址在Monero中也得到了应用。

        在Monero的实现中,每次交易都生成一个一次性地址,确保只有接收者能够访问与其关联的交易。这种动态地址生成的方法有效阻止了用户的持续性身份暴露,极大增强了隐私保护的效果。

        4. 同态加密(Homomorphic Encryption)

        同态加密是一种允许在加密数据上执行计算的加密技术,而无需解密数据。它对隐私保护的意义在于,用户可以在不暴露数据内容的情况下,完成数据处理和计算,确保了隐私的安全性。

        尽管同态加密在计算成本和技术成熟度方面还存在一些挑战,部分研究已经证明这一技术在区块链系统中有着潜在的巨大应用前景,例如在保护用户身份的基础上进行智能合约的执行。

        5. 盲签名(Blind Signature)

        盲签名是一种允许发送者要求第三方对其信息进行签名,而在此过程中,第三方无法阅读信息的签名方式。这种协议在金融交易中得到广泛应用,尤其是在需要隐私保护的情况下。

        通过使用盲签名,用户可以安全地进行交易,信息内容不会被签名方所知。比如,许多数字货币项目在交易过程中,会利用盲签名技术来确保双方能够进行交易,而不会泄露私人信息。

        三、区块链隐私保护的应用场景

        隐私保护协议的实施,为多个行业带来了潜在的变革。在金融、医疗、政府等领域,隐私保护都是至关重要的环节。以下是一些具体的应用场景:

        1. 数字货币交易

        在数字货币交易中,用户的信息隐私尤其重要。使用如Zcash或Monero这样的隐私币,可以在不暴露身份的情况下完成交易。这对于希望保护个人资产和交易行为的用户尤为重要。

        2. 供应链管理

        在供应链管理中,保持产品选择和供应链环节的机密性显得尤为重要。通过隐私保护协议,参与方可在共享必要的信息的同时,确保其商业机密和供应链数据不被泄露。

        3. 医疗数据管理

        医疗信息的共享必须在保护患者隐私的前提下进行。通过使用加密技术和隐私协议,医生及医院可有效地共享患者的医疗数据,同时确保患者隐私得到保护。

        四、未来的发展趋势

        随着对隐私保护的需求不断上升,区块链隐私保护协议正在快速演进。以下是一些值得关注的发展趋势:

        1. 标准化与互操作性

        未来隐私保护协议可能会朝着标准化的方向发展,以提高不同区块链之间的互操作性。通过制定相应的标准,能够帮助各个平台之间更好地实现隐私保护协议的应用。

        2. 跨链隐私保护

        区块链网络的多样性促进了对跨链隐私保护的需求。未来的隐私保护协议将致力于确保不同区块链之间的信息流动安全和私密,从而实现更为广泛的应用场景。

        3. 更多的应用案例

        隐私保护技术的创新和应用将加速到来,未来可能在社会的各个层面收到更多的关注和开发。特别是在商业和金融领域,隐私保护的需求将推动新应用的落地。

        可能相关的问题

        1. 区块链隐私保护协议为什么重要?

        隐私保护协议的重要性源于区块链透明性的特性。虽然这种透明性有助于信任的建立,但同时也导致了个人隐私的风险。隐私保护协议能够在维护这些利益之间取得平衡,推动更广泛的区块链应用发展。

        2. 隐私保护协议是如何实现匿名性的?

        匿名性是隐私保护协议的核心特征之一,各种技术如环签名、零知识证明等在此过程中发挥了关键作用。通过这些技术,用户可以在维持交易安全的前提下,隐藏个人身份和交易细节。

        3. 现行区块链隐私协议的局限性有哪些?

        现有隐私保护协议虽然提供了数据保护,但也存在如计算复杂性高、技术实现难度大等局限性。此外,某些协议可能会被监管机构质疑,要求对其透明性进行检验,导致其在某些行业应用中面临挑战。

        4. 未来区块链隐私保护协议的发展方向是什么?

        未来的发展方向可能会着重于各类标准化的制定和跨链隐私协议的实现。同时,随着新技术如人工智能与区块链的结合,隐私保护的方式也可能会发生变革,实现更高安全级别的隐私保护。

        5. 隐私保护协议的实际案例分析

        通过对Zcash、Monero等典型隐私币的深入分析,可以看出不同隐私保护技术的实际应用效果。这些案例展现了隐私协议在真实场景中的应用潜力,并为未来更加广泛的隐私保护技术创新提供了借鉴。

        结论

        在数字经济日益增长的今天,区块链隐私保护协议的重要性愈发显著。尽管当前的隐私技术仍面临诸多挑战,但随着技术的发展及多方共识的建立,相信未来隐私保护协议将迎来更好的发展机遇。通过关注和探索这些协议的实践,我们将能更好地实现区块链技术在各行业的应用,同时保护用户的隐私与安全。